Editorial overview Touché

How the Body Stops Working Thirteen Kid-Friendly Explanations by Jill Macfarlane is a 32-page book published by CreateSpace Independent Publishing Platform on December 4, 2017. This edition addresses the complex and often difficult questions children ask about death and dying, providing clear and age-appropriate explanations for young readers aged 6 to 10. The book aims to present topics such as cancer, dementia, and other causes of death in a way that is informative yet gentle, helping to demystify the concept of dying.

Readers will find that this book serves as a valuable resource for discussing sensitive subjects related to death, grief, and bereavement. Accompanied by illustrations, the explanations are designed to be accessible and reassuring, making it suitable for use in various settings, including counseling and medical environments, as well as at home. Through its thoughtful approach, How the Body Stops Working offers a means for children to understand that death can be discussed openly without fear.


Official synopsis Publisher

“What does dead mean?”

“What is cancer?”

“How does someone die?”

“Will she come back?”

Children are notorious for asking profound and profoundly challenging questions, especially when it comes to death and dying. Adults struggle at times to express the truth about dying in ways that are honest and age appropriate without being scary or confusing.

In How the Body Dies: Thirteen Kid-Friendly Explanations, children from ages 6 – 10 will find death defined and demystified. From cancer and dementia, to stroke, heart attack, suicide and addiction, these explanations are accompanied by informative and gentle illustrations which add to the explanatory nature of the book.

In counseling offices, doctor’s offices, hospitals, and at home, you will find this book invaluable in explaining dying to children to help them understand that death doesn’t have to be scary.
